The Kern County Latino COVID-19 Task Force, Kern County Public Health and Kern County Hispanic Chamber of Commerce are hosting free COVID-19 testing sites Friday through Sunday in neighborhoods.

“As the holiday season approaches, it’s important to not get comfortable and ignore the current situation of the COVID-19 pandemic,” said Jay Tamsi, co-founder of the Kern County Latino COVID-19 Task Force.  “This pandemic is real, and we should not stay complacent.”

The county is still required to meet state guidelines to remain at this stage of being open or to be moved forward. Among the key weekly benchmarks are increased testing results.

The first testing site will be open Friday beginning at 11 a.m. at the McFarland Blanco Park, 105 Wiley St. McFarland 93250.

The second testing site will be open Saturday from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m. at the Oildale Centennial Square North on the corner of North Chester And Norris Road.

The third and final testing site will open Sunday beginning at 9 a.m. at the Vallarta Supermarkets Delano, 820 Main Street, Delano, Ca 93215.
